Jack Mayer Posted February 15, 2017 Report Share Posted February 15, 2017 I found that the front air ride on my previous 780 improved the ride significantly. It did make the truck seem to "float" more from a handling input perspective. But it is something you get used to fast. It is a tradeoff, for sure. My new truck does not have front air ride. I had to replace the cab airbags and shocks because the cab was wallowing all over the place. So if you have that wallowing feeling perhaps you need cab suspension work....not axle suspension. And, BTW, if you like more "sports car" like road input then take a close look at the Kenworths, because the feel is totally different than a Volvo.
